The Next Generation of Soccer Superstars
As the world of soccer continues to evolve, the emergence of young, talented players is changing the dynamics of the sport. With each new season, fans and analysts eagerly anticipate the rise of the next generation of superstars who will leave their mark on the game. In this article, we delve into some of the brightest prospects making waves in the leagues across the globe.
1. The Phenomenon of Youth Football Academies
Football academies are becoming increasingly important in nurturing young talent. Clubs are investing heavily in these programs to develop their future stars from a young age. Players who once faced limitations due to lack of resources are now being scouted at an early age, thanks to improved scouting systems and investment in youth setups.
2. Spotlight on Emerging Talents
Among the many talented young players, a few stand out due to their extraordinary skills and performances in their respective leagues. Players like Jude Bellingham, Gavi, and Pedri have already made significant impacts at their clubs and are being hailed as future legends of the game. They are not just performing at high levels but also handling the pressures of top-flight football with remarkable maturity.
3. Jude Bellingham: A Midfield Maestro
Jude Bellingham has taken the football world by storm since his move to Real Madrid. His ability to control the midfield, coupled with his vision and passing range, makes him one of the most exciting young talents to watch. An integral part of his club's success, his performances in recent matches have showcased his capability to influence games at the highest level.
4. Gavi: The Catalan Jewel
Gavi, the young midfielder from FC Barcelona, has quickly become a household name. His tenacity, skill, and ability to read the game have earned him a regular spot in the starting XI. As he continues to hone his craft, it’s clear that he possesses the potential to become one of the best in the world.
5. Pedri: The Playmaker of the Future
Another gem from Barcelona, Pedri's creativity and football IQ set him apart. His performances in La Liga have been nothing short of spectacular, making him a key player for both club and country. Fans eagerly await his every touch, as he seems destined for greatness.
6. The Role of International Tournaments
International tournaments serve as a platform for young players to showcase their talents on a global stage. Events like the UEFA European Under-21 Championship and the FIFA U-20 World Cup provide these young athletes with invaluable experience. Performances in these tournaments often propel players into the spotlight, leading to potential transfers to larger clubs.
7. The Impact of Social Media on Young Players
In today’s digital age, young players are often thrust into the limelight before they even step onto the pitch professionally. Social media platforms have allowed fans to follow their journeys closely, which can be both a blessing and a curse. While it provides them with a massive platform to showcase their skills, it also puts immense pressure on them to perform consistently.
